Publisher's Summary

The Covenant mission is the most ambitious endeavor in the history of Weyland-Yutani. A ship bound for Origae-6, carrying 2,000 colonists beyond the limits of known space, this is a make-or-break investment for the corporation - and for the future of all mankind.

Yet there are those who would die to stop the mission. As the colony ship hovers in Earth orbit, several violent events reveal a deadly conspiracy to sabotage the launch. While Captain Jacob Branson and his wife, Daniels, complete their preparations, security chief Daniel Lope recruits the final key member of his team. Together they seek to stop the perpetrators before the ship and its passengers can be destroyed.

An original novel by the acclaimed Alan Dean Foster, author of the groundbreaking Alien novelization, Alien: Covenant Origins is the official chronicle of the events that led up to Alien: Covenant. It also reveals the world the colonists left behind.

Ummmm yea. Skip this one…

The first hour I thought, “Finally! A story about a colony ship!”
Then the rest of the books takes place on earth. In conference rooms dealing with corporation policies. No joke the whole time.
No aliens.
Worst part is. You know who the villains are, and you’re waiting for the characters to catch up to what you knew from the second chapter.
One of the most pointless books added to the alien series.
